Advanced Electrical Power Generation and Distribution Concepts for Military Facilities.

Abstract

The report describes probable technical advancement of electrical power generation systems in the 1980-1990 time period for application in fixed or semi-fixed military facilities in the power range of 250 kw to 50,000 kw. Subjects covered include commercial power reliability, uninterruptible power system, conventional steam, diesel, gas turbine (open and closed cycle) generators and distribution systems for currently available equipment. Advanced power systems include nuclear reactors, batteries and fuel cells, magnetohydrodynamic systems, fusion systems, solar power systems and direct conversion systems of the thermoelectric and thermionic type.
